Factors that lead to decreased fluid intake in older adults include
a. decreased sweating.
b. fear of incontinence.
c. decreased salt intake.
d. preference for food rather than fluids.
B
Older adults may restrict their fluid intake because of fear of incontinence. Older adults do not usually have lower salt intakes or prefer food rather than fluids. They may sweat less, which makes them more sensitive to heat but does not usually cause them to decrease fluid intake.
